币安API Key是什么?币安API Key创建与使用完整教程
什么是币安 API Key?
币安 API Key 是连接币安账户与第三方程序、交易工具或自建系统的身份凭证。简单理解,它就像“应用的通行证”,用于让程序读取账户数据、执行交易或调用接口。对于想要做量化交易、资产查询、自动化策略或资产聚合的人来说,API Key 是进入币安生态的第一步。
在实际使用中,币安 API 通常由两部分组成:API Key 和 Secret Key。前者用于标识身份,后者用于签名验证。请注意,Secret Key 只会在创建时显示一次,务必妥善保存。
第一步:先确认你的使用目的
在创建币安 API Key 之前,建议先明确你要做什么。不同用途对应的权限应该不同,避免“开太多权限”带来风险。
- 仅查询资产:只开读取权限即可。
- 自动下单:需要交易权限。
- 程序化转账或提币:风险更高,通常还需要 IP 白名单等额外限制。
- 第三方工具接入:尽量只授权该工具真正需要的功能。
第二步:登录币安并进入 API 管理页面
登录你的币安账户后,进入个人中心或账户设置,找到API 管理入口。不同端的菜单名称可能略有差异,但通常都能在“账户”“个人资料”或“安全设置”中找到。
进入 API 管理后,点击创建新 API。此时系统一般会要求你进行邮箱验证、手机验证或身份验证,这是正常的安全流程。
第三步:创建并命名你的 API Key
创建时,币安通常会要求你填写一个标签名称。这个名称主要用于识别用途,比如:
- QuantBot
- 资产查询
- 现货策略A
- Crypto Pro
建议使用“用途清晰、便于区分”的命名方式,方便后续管理多个 API Key。创建完成后,系统会生成 API Key 和 Secret Key。请立即复制并安全保存。
第四步:设置权限,按需开启
这是最关键的一步。创建完成后,不要直接默认全开,而是根据用途勾选权限。一般来说,常见权限包括:
- 只读权限:用于查看账户资产、余额、订单信息。
- 现货交易权限:用于买卖现货。
- 杠杆或合约权限:用于衍生品交易。
- 提币权限:风险最高,非必要不建议开启。
如果你只是把币安账户接入行情工具或资产统计工具,通常只需要只读权限。如果你要接入交易机器人,再考虑开启交易权限。不需要的权限一律不要开,这是保护资产安全的重要原则。
第五步:开启 IP 白名单,进一步提高安全性
币安强烈建议为 API Key 设置 IP 白名单。开启后,只有指定 IP 地址才能调用该 API,这样即便密钥泄露,也能降低被滥用的风险。
如果你是个人开发者,建议先确认自己服务器的公网 IP,再将其加入白名单。若你使用的是云服务器、固定代理或静态出口网络,管理会更方便。对于经常变动网络环境的设备,IP 白名单设置可能会带来一定维护成本,但安全性明显更高。
第六步:保存 Secret Key,并完成首次接入
创建成功后,币安通常只会完整展示一次 Secret Key。你需要:
- 立即复制并离线保存
- 不要发到聊天工具里
- 不要写进公开代码仓库
- 不要明文存储在共享文档中
如果你要将币安 API 接入第三方工具,通常需要在工具的设置页中填写这两个字段。常见流程是:进入设置页面,选择 Binance,粘贴 API Key 与 Secret Key,保存后进行连接测试。
第七步:测试连接并检查权限状态
完成绑定后,建议先做一次小范围测试,例如:
- 查询余额是否正常
- 读取订单是否成功
- 交易下单是否有权限报错
如果出现错误,优先检查以下几项:
- API Key 或 Secret Key 是否复制错误
- 权限是否开启正确
- IP 白名单是否包含当前出口 IP
- 账户是否完成必要的安全验证
很多“连接失败”问题,其实都不是接口本身有问题,而是权限、IP 或密钥填写错误。
币安 API Key 使用安全建议
API Key 本质上相当于“账户授权钥匙”,因此安全管理非常重要。建议你牢记以下原则:
- 不要共享:不要把 API Key 发给任何不必要的人。
- 不要全权限开启:按用途最小化授权。
- 不要明文存储:优先使用环境变量或密钥管理工具。
- 定期轮换:长期不用的 Key 建议删除或重建。
- 优先使用 IP 白名单:尤其是交易和转账场景。
如果你怀疑 API Key 已泄露,建议立即停用该 Key,重新生成新的密钥组合,并检查账户安全设置。
常见使用场景
币安 API Key 的应用非常广泛,常见场景包括:
- 自动化量化交易
- 资产聚合与持仓分析
- 跟单或策略执行
- 第三方行情软件接入
- 企业内部交易系统对接
对于普通用户来说,最常见的需求往往是“查看资产”和“连接交易工具”。只要按照最小权限原则配置,币安 API Key 可以在提升效率的同时,把风险控制在合理范围内。
总结
币安 API Key 的创建并不复杂,关键在于正确设置权限、妥善保管 Secret Key、尽量开启 IP 白名单。如果你是新手,建议先从只读权限开始,确认流程熟悉后,再逐步配置交易类权限。这样既能完成币安 API 接入,也能更好地保护自己的数字资产安全。
立体问答
8 张卡片币安 API Key 和 Secret Key 有什么区别?
API Key 用于标识你的身份,Secret Key 用于签名验证。前者相当于账号标识,后者相当于私密密码,必须妥善保存。
创建币安 API Key 需要收费吗?
通常不需要额外收费,创建 API Key 本身是免费的,但具体功能取决于你的账户权限和使用场景。
币安 API Key 可以只开读取权限吗?
可以,而且如果你只是查看资产或连接行情工具,建议只开启读取权限,降低风险。
为什么币安 API 建议设置 IP 白名单?
IP 白名单可以限制只有指定地址才能访问 API,即便密钥泄露,也能减少被他人滥用的风险。
Secret Key 忘记保存了怎么办?
如果 Secret Key 没有保存,通常无法再次查看,建议删除该 API Key 并重新创建一组新的密钥。
币安 API Key 可以用于自动交易吗?
可以,只要你在创建后开启了交易权限,并正确接入交易程序或机器人即可。
API 连接失败最常见的原因是什么?
常见原因包括密钥填写错误、权限未开启、IP 白名单不匹配、账户安全验证未完成等。
币安 API Key 泄露后该怎么处理?
应立即停用或删除泄露的 API Key,重新生成新的密钥,并检查账户是否存在异常操作。